BODYBAR Pilates Expands Long Island Footprint with Hauppauge Studio
A former pharmacist and entrepreneur is bringing a new athletic-focused fitness concept to Suffolk County this September. Mady Pisano, owner of the upcoming 3,200-square-foot BODYBAR Pilates in Hauppauge, aims to blend high-intensity reformer training with a community-centric approach, marking the brand’s second expansion on Long Island.

Pisano, who also operates RelyRx Pharmacy, views the studio as a personal mission to foster wellness after discovering the brand through its founders, Matt and Kamille McCollum. Her expansion plans extend beyond this initial site; she has already signed a two-unit development agreement with intentions to open a second location in Southern Long Island by 2027 and eventually scale to four additional studios. The Hauppauge opening is part of a broader national push for the franchise, which currently operates 89 locations with 30 more expected to launch by the end of the year.
